What are the key geographical features contributing to salt production in Gujarat?
Gujarat's salt production is significantly influenced by its extensive coastline, including the Gulf of Kachchh and the Gulf of Khambhat, which provide ideal conditions for salt pans and salt flats.
Which historical events are associated with the destruction of temples by the Delhi Sultanate in Gujarat?
The Delhi Sultanate, particularly under rulers like Allaudin Khilji, conducted several raids and conquests in Gujarat, leading to the destruction of numerous temples, including the Somnath temple.
What is the geographical location of the Harappan site Lothal?
Lothal is located in the Dholka Taluka of Ahmedabad district in Gujarat. It is one of the most important archaeological sites of the Indus Valley Civilization.
What are the historical conquests of Ala-ud-din Khalji in Gujarat?
Ala-ud-din Khalji, a ruler of the Delhi Sultanate, conquered Gujarat in the early 14th century, capturing key cities and plundering wealth, including the famous Somnath temple.
What are the geographical features of the Gujarat coast?
The Gujarat coast is characterized by two major gulfs, the Gulf of Kachchh and the Gulf of Khambhat, which are important for trade and salt production. The coast also includes several ports and estuaries.
